Winter travels

Posted 05-18-2009 at 02:01 PM by Dave LeClair

Started out on Vancouver Island BC Canada March 27th and experienced -6 temperters on the parries .Had a lay over in Thunder Bay Ontario with 2 feet of snow.The traveling was good all the way to New Brunswick where I'm parked on the 27th of April at a great RV park on the Pedecodiac River south of Moncton. I'm about 3 miles from the Hope Well Rocks.NB
It was a trip to remember.I pulled my 31 foot land yacht with a half ton Dodge 5.7 ltr.hemi with no problem.
